📌 PYQs = UPSC’s Favourite Clue! Look at Question 87 👆. The same theme/question has appeared in UPSC CSE 2025, CAPF 2025 and now CDS-II 2026. This is exactly why Previous Year Questions (PYQs) are non-negotiable for CAPF Paper-I preparation. UPSC may not always repeat a question word-to-word, but it repeats themes, concepts, facts and even questions across different examinations. 👉 PYQs tell you what UPSC considers important. 👉 They reveal the examiner’s pattern and favourite areas. 👉 They help you distinguish important facts from unnecessary information. 👉 And sometimes, as we can see here, the same question can come back! So don't treat PYQs as just practice questions. Study them as a roadmap to UPSC’s thinking. 🎯 For CAPF aspirants: PYQs → Analyse → Identify recurring themes → Prepare those areas thoroughly. The smartest preparation isn't about reading everything. It's about knowing what UPSC repeatedly asks.

HOLDING A MIRROR TO GDP NUMBERS India's strong GDP growth does not necessarily mean that every citizen is experiencing better economic conditions. GDP measures the value of final goods and services produced within an economy, but does not directly capture employment quality, real wages, inequality or living standards. Therefore, economic health should also be assessed through employment, real wages, consumption, investment, productivity and manufacturing performance. CAPF Angle: GDP + Inclusive Growth + Employment + Manufacturing + Economic Development. Takeaway: High GDP growth is important, but growth becomes meaningful when it translates into jobs, incomes and better living standards.

AI IN SCHOOLS: LESSONS FROM NEW YORK New York City has introduced age-based curbs on AI tools and screen time in public schools, focusing instead on teaching students how AI works, its limitations and responsible use. India’s concern: Rising smartphone/social-media use and growing AI adoption in education can lead to digital addiction and excessive dependence on technology. AI should support learning, not replace critical thinking and independent learning. CAPF Angle: AI + Education + Digital Divide + AI Ethics + Child Rights. Takeaway: India needs AI literacy and responsible digital use, rather than either blind adoption or a complete ban.
